NVIDIA GeForce RTX 4080 vs AMD Radeon HD 6450
NVIDIA GeForce RTX 4080 vs AMD Radeon HD 6450
VS
NVIDIA GeForce RTX 4080
AMD Radeon HD 6450
We compared two Desktop platform GPUs: 16GB VRAM GeForce RTX 4080 and 512MB VRAM Radeon HD 6450 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ce RTX 4080 's Advantages
Released 11 years and 5 months late
Boost Clock2505MHz
Larger VRAM bandwidth (716.8GB/s vs 25.60GB/s)
9568 additional rendering cores
AMD Radeon HD 6450 's Advantages
Lower TDP (18W vs 320W)
